The car is a 997 c2s, 05, arctic silver, ocean full leather, sports chrono plus, PSE although it is not adjustable at the moment and i am not totally sure if it is pse or just a sports exhaust as was not on original options list, been told it may of been modified to allow loud exhaust with smooth map?

Car is a bit tatty cosmetically which put me off at first but it drove very well, 78k miles, 3 owners, 1 opc service and 3 at Strasse, looks like recent discs and pads, pilot sports about 4mm ish, price is £22k.

I have talked the dealer into driving the car down from London area on Thursday for the inspection, if JMG say it does not need too much to get on the plan i will go for it.......although i have just been emailed from PH about a car for £23.5k 04-05 same colour 66k which is in exceptional condition :?
